Out.com Logo The World’s Top Out Athletes Featured In Nike BeTrue Campaign

The World’s Top Out Athletes Featured In Nike BeTrue Campaign

By Staff

Cyberspace — Nike’s back with another year of its BeTrue campaign, which has been supporting LGBTQ+ people in sports and beyond since 2012. This year, however, Nike is not just slapping any old rainbow on its products—it’s partnered with the estate of Gilbert Baker, the political activist who claimed the rainbow for LGBTQ+ people by creating the pride flag. TowleRoad Logo NYPD Commissioner Apologizes To LGBTQ Community For 1969 Raid On Stonewall Inn

NYPD Commissioner Apologizes To LGBTQ Community For 1969 Raid On Stonewall Inn

By Staff

New York City — NYPD Commissioner James O’Neill apologized today to the LGBTQ community for the 1969 raid on the Stonewall Inn in Greenwich Village that took place 50 years ago this month which is seen as the birth of the modern LGBTQ rights movement. (More)
